Which medication is commonly used as a first-line uterotonic in the postpartum period to treat hemorrhage?

Explanation:
The key idea here is promoting uterine contraction to control postpartum hemorrhage. The best initial choice is oxytocin because it rapidly stimulates the uterus to contract, helping compress bleeding vessels after delivery. It acts on uterine oxytocin receptors to increase calcium in smooth muscle, producing effective contractions that reduce blood loss. Oxytocin is fast-acting, easy to titrate, and has a favorable safety profile, which is why it’s used routinely as the first-line uterotonic after delivery and as part of active management of the third stage of labor. Ibuprofen and fentanyl do not affect uterine tone and are used for pain and analgesia, not for stopping hemorrhage. Hemabate can promote contractions as well, but it carries more significant side effects (diarrhea, vomiting, bronchospasm) and is typically reserved for when oxytocin alone isn’t sufficient or in specific clinical scenarios.

Exam Format

The HESI Obstetrics and Maternity Exam comprises a series of multiple-choice questions designed to assess your knowledge and clinical judgment. Typically, the test includes:

  • Approximately 55-75 items
  • Questions covering a range of topics such as antepartum, intrapartum, postpartum, and newborn care
  • Scenarios requiring application of nursing processes and clinical reasoning

The exam duration is generally 1-1.5 hours, allowing sufficient time for careful consideration of each question. It's vital to understand that questions might integrate nursing concepts from various areas, simulating real-world scenarios that nurses encounter in their practice.

What to Expect on the Exam

Preparation for the HESI Obstetrics and Maternity Exam demands a comprehensive understanding of maternity nursing concepts. Here are key areas often emphasized:

Antepartum Care

  • Comprehensive prenatal assessment and care
  • Addressing high-risk pregnancies
  • Nutritional needs and psychological support during pregnancy

Intrapartum Care

  • Labor and delivery practices
  • Pain management techniques
  • Fetal monitoring and interpretation

Postpartum Care

  • Post-delivery recovery and complications
  • Education for new mothers
  • Addressing emotional and psychological needs

Newborn Care

  • Neonatal assessments
  • Routine care and potential complications
  • Newborn nutritional needs

Expect questions requiring critical thinking, prioritization, and safety measures to ensure optimal maternal and neonatal outcomes.
